Let S be the universal set, where: S = {1, 2, 3, ..., 18, 19, 20} Let sets A and B be subsets of S, where: Set A = {1, 5, 7, 11, 12, 14, 19, 20} Set B = {1, 4, 5, 7, 8, 10, 13, 14, 15, 19, 20} Find the following: LIST the elements in the set (A union B): (A union B) = Enter the elements as a list, separated by commas. If the result is the empty set, enter DNE LIST the elements in the set (A intersection B): Enter the elements as a list, separated by commas. If the result is the empty set, enter DNE

Solution

We have AUB = {1,5,7,11,12,14,19,20} U { 1,4,5,7,8,10,13,14,15,19,20} = {1,4,5,7,8,10,11,12,13,14,15,19,20}. We have AB = {1,5,7,11,12,14,19,20} { 1,4,5,7,8,10,13,14,15,19,20} = { 1,5,7,14,19,20}.
